Get the Summary of Richard Ayoade's Ayoade on Top in 20 minutes. Please note: This is a summary & not the original book. "Ayoade on Top" by Richard Ayoade is a detailed critique of the 2003 film "View from the Top," starring Gwyneth Paltrow. Ayoade humorously likens reading his book to an airplane journey, as he delves into the film's narrative and its personal impact on him. He describes his meticulous preparation for watching the film and defends it against criticisms, arguing for its celebration of capitalism and hard work...

Inspired by Dostoyevsky's short story, The Double tells the story of Simon, a timid man, scratching out an isolated existence in an indifferent world. He is overlooked at work, scorned by his mother, and ignored by the woman of his dreams. He feels powerless to change any of these things. The arrival of a new co-worker, James, serves to upset the balance. James is both Simon's exact physical double and his opposite - confident, charismatic and good with women. To Simon's horror, James slowly starts taking over his life.

Her Again is an intimate look at the artistic coming-of-age of the greatest actress of her generation, from the homecoming float at her suburban New Jersey high school to her star-making roles in The Deer Hunter, Manhattan, and Kramer vs. Kramer. The book charts Meryl Streep's heady rise to stardom on the New York stage, her passionate, tragically short-lived love affair with fellow actor John Cazale, and her evolution as a young woman of the 1970s wrestling with changing ideas of feminism, marriage, love, and sacrifice. This is a captivating story of the making of one of the most revered artistic careers of our time, offering a rare glimpse into the life of the actress long before she became an icon.
